| #: | AI *may* do | AI *must NOT* do |
|---|------------------------------------------------------------------------|-------------------------------------------------------------------------------------|
| G-0 | Whenever unsure about something that's related to the project, ask the developer for clarification before making changes. | ❌ Write changes or use tools when you are not sure about something project specific, or if you don't have context for a particular feature/decision. |
| G-1 | Generate code **only inside** relevant source directories (e.g., `agents_api/` for the main API, `cli/src/` for the CLI, `integrations/` for integration-specific code) or explicitly pointed files. | ❌ Touch `tests/`, `SPEC.md`, or any `*_spec.py` / `*.ward` files (humans own tests & specs). |
| G-1 | Generate code **only inside** relevant source directories (e.g., `agents_api/` for the main API, `cli/src/` for the CLI, `integrations/` for integration-specific code) or explicitly pointed files. | ❌ Touch `tests/`, `SPEC.md`, or any `*_spec.py` files (humans own tests & specs). |
| G-2 | Add/update **`AIDEV-NOTE:` anchor comments** near non-trivial edited code. | ❌ Delete or mangle existing `AIDEV-` comments. |
| G-3 | Follow lint/style configs (`pyproject.toml`, `.ruff.toml`, `.pre-commit-config.yaml`). Use the project's configured linter, if available, instead of manually re-formatting code. | ❌ Re-format code to any other style. |
| G-4 | For changes >300 LOC or >3 files, **ask for confirmation**. | ❌ Refactor large modules without human guidance. |

* **Execution**: The runtime instance and state of a task being performed by an agent. Core model in `typespec/executions/models.tsp`.
* **POE (PoeThePoet)**: The task runner used in this project for development tasks like formatting, linting, testing, and code generation (configured in `pyproject.toml`).
* **TypeSpec**: The language used to define API schemas. It is the source of truth for API models, which are then generated into Python Pydantic models in `autogen/` directories.
* **Ward**: The primary Python testing framework used for unit and integration tests in most components (e.g., `agents-api`, `cli`).
* **Pytest**: The primary Python testing framework used for unit and integration tests in all components.
* **Temporal**: The distributed workflow engine used to orchestrate complex, long-running tasks and ensure their reliable execution.
* **AIDEV-NOTE/TODO/QUESTION**: Specially formatted comments to provide inline context or tasks for AI assistants and developers.
